Transaction e3521652db505861012e143b0ff2f59ca3cca6a30e6ab606e5e238ac785142a2
1 Input
2 Outputs
- e3521652db505861012e143b0ff2f59ca3cca6a30e6ab606e5e238ac785142a2:0
- e3521652db505861012e143b0ff2f59ca3cca6a30e6ab606e5e238ac785142a2:1
value 547741
address 172SHrZSPPbshNMHkx9juicw5qtfFXkqPa
value 646805
address 3AwHVHM7bdTrD8hbzkzUBsDuwE2WARHxac